"In HINDSIGHT: Buying from your town's electronic chain store or retailer might be a wiser choice to buy new Mac systems over B&H. In retrospect: I bought a new MacBook Unibody from an authorized reseller (not B&H) on 9/24/10 and arrived with a defective Optical Drive. The Mac's OD can only be replaced by the manufacturer and not the entire unit because I bought it somewhere else and not from them or directly from their own retail store, and so I had the OD replaced because it will take me at least two weeks (or more) to finally get a replacement from the merchant considering shipping from West Coast to East and back and processing time. I sold that MacBook after a month anyways. ----- On 11/1, I bought a new MacBook Pro from B&H. I had a pleasant experience with the order and the shipping rates were cheap and the Mac came with sufficient protection. I have been a satisfied B&H customer, back from my first ever camera in 2001. Total savings is $160.00, good towards accessories and softwares. Now, here's the problem: The new MacBook Pro had an intermittently working power board (the one soldered to the body). The manufacturer had diagnosed and confirmed that it was the machine and not the power adapter. My only option, because I bought it not from them or any of their retail store chain, is to have it repaired or sent back to B&H for replacement. Because this is my 2nd sub-par new Mac system in 7 weeks since the white MacBook Unibody, I did not settle for a repair this time and had the machine sent back to B&H which they gladly setup an RMA and prepaid return label. B&H upgraded the shipping from the original 3-day to 2-day shipping for free in order for me to receive the replacement quickly. Now, where can you find one like that? ----- This is an isolated case and only fate can be blamed but I can't tell the odds of you getting a defective Mac so the lesson from this saga is that it might be wiser buying a Mac from the manufacturer or any of its retail stores or from any national electronics chains, if you live in the West Coast. Look at me, I bought two new Macs from different merchants from across the country and both are defective machines, those were my odds."

"I initially had apprehension about buying because their 13" white unibody MacBook 2.4 GHz is only $849.99 after $105.00 rebate. It was too good to be true especially that a rebate exists for this Mac. After careful research, I found them to be one of only few Apple Authorized Resellers on Apple.com with BH Photo, Best Buy, JR, Fry's and MacConnection's other site PCConnection. So I took the risk and found out it was pleasant to do business with them. The MacBook shipped fast, sealed and carefully packaged in another huge box. I called them up the day of the ETA from UPS to change my mind and return the Mac and so they were kind enough not to charge me a restocking fee as long as I return it unopened. I changed my mind and kept the system. The MacBook came with factory defect though. The Optical Drive is defective. The agent at MacConnection was very prompt in all his response. I have emailed them only about my case and answered all my questions. He gave me a Return Authorization with prepaid shipping (because the product was defective) and will ship me a new Mac once they got back the defective one. I decided I keep the Mac and go back to Apple to have the Optical Drive replaced. Regarding the rebate, the Mac has identical UPC label on the white box and the manila box it is in. Agent had me cut the UPC on the manila box retaining the white Apple box intact. I had no trouble at all from this merchant. I will perhaps come back to them when I upgrade to MacBook Pro. UPDATE: I received the $105.00 rebate, about 5 weeks after submission. Not bad, at par with all other rebates from other stores."

"Very reliable indeed. There were no phone numbers to contact them so I was very skeptic on buying from their website. The only communication is through email. The prices were so tempting and the agent agent guaranteed that they are authentic products. Found out that the email responses were actually fast, of course give or take a few minutes to assume perhaps the agent is taking a pee or lunch break. All my emails were actually replied to. Ordered the Ray-Ban RX 5169 Havana on Green. Sales agent notified me right away that the color I wanted is not available and offered me a different color for the same size and also offered me 10% off lens and frame for the hassle. I said cancel the order and they did. Received email after a few hours to tell me that they indeed have the one I wanted on stock. Although the discount is for a different color, the agent still applied that to my original order. Desperate to have my glasses for my upcoming trip, I told agent (Amy Townsend) if she could do something to speed it up and she did. Order was completed in two days and it was delivered two days after, from NYC to West Coast with tracking info. I went to my optometrist to check the authenticity of the Ray-Ban, the polycarbonate lens, and the AR coating and she confirmed that they were all genuine. The Ray Ban is original, the lens is indeed polycarbonate and the AR coating is very obvious. I had pleasant experience dealing with them so I will definitely buy from them again on my next vision insurance eligibility (they don't accept insurance so I had asked my vision insurance to reimburse me). My technique is to go to LensCrafters or Pearle Vision, try the frames, remember the model # and size, go back to Eyegoodies' website and lookup that model."

"Found this merchant through Amazon.com. Their 32" Toshiba LCD HDTV is at least $140 cheaper than Bestbuy and Circuit City, and $50 cheaper than most online merchants. After so much thought, I bought the 32" Toshiba from 6th Ave through Amazon.com as they have 97%+ positive rating on Amazon and a BBB certificate displayed on their website. I was very pleased with my order. Arrived 1 day early. Free shipping for a 41-lb TV. The unit was factory sealed and brand new. It is even boxed and cushioned to protect the TV's main packaging. Good thing I found this merchant. The TV was working good initially, but when I hooked it up with my Sony 1080p DVD upscaler the left speaker went berserk on Rocky and LOTR: The Return of the King. It was defective, the left speaker. It would randomly create short-circuit sound on scenes with intense sound. It is definitely not the bass, as the right speaker handled it well. I called customer service and I'm surprised with the good service, sent me a prepaid return shipping label for a full refund. I called again to have it exchanged for a Sony Bravia 32" and will pay the difference, and they gave me 10% off the Bravia for the exchange (fabulous!). I called again the next day to cancel the whole thing and refund the money instead as I desperately need a new TV for friends coming for the holidays and can't wait for the free ground shipping. The customer service agents handled my calls really well, except for one female agent who (unintentionally?) cut me off while talking on the phone asking for a cancellation of the Sony and switching back to full refund. The TV wasn't their fault, it was defective. I know very well because the product was sealed and the TV was sealed with all the plastic films covering it. I've heard about lapses in Toshiba quality as my friend's Toshiba DVD 1080p upscaler didn't last 90 days. I just thought it wouldn't happen to me, which unfortunately it did. Overall I am very pleased and will consider them again in the future. Perhaps they have changed management. They have BBB on their website now, so that gives me comfort. They have 97%++ rating on Amazon.com, that's a very tangible number to bank on."
